VOLUNTEER BUSH FIRE BRIGADES

BORNHOLM - ELLEKER - TORBAY - YOUNGS SIDING

Volunteer bush fire brigades all over Australia provide a vital service to the community, protecting life and property when bush fires, one of the ever present dangers of life in this country, flare up.  Even in this fairly temperate part of the country we have seen the sort of conditions which make bushfires so devastating in less fortunate areas, and whilst losses have luckily been kept to a minimum, constant vigilance is needed.

One of the ways in which you can help your community and yourself is to become a member of your local bush fire brigade.  You may not wish to be actively involved in fighting fires, but your donations will help to keep this danger under control.

You should also familiarise yourself with the content of your Firebreak Notice, issued by the City of Albany, and ensure that any burning is carried out in accordance with that notice.
